Current industrial trends in Nassau and Freeport indicate a shift toward Logistics 4.0. With the rise of e-commerce and the need for faster turnaround times for imported goods, traditional manual warehousing is no longer sufficient. Local businesses in the food & beverage, hospitality supply chain, and construction sectors are increasingly seeking Automated Storage and Retrieval Systems (ASRS) to optimize limited land space on the islands while ensuring high throughput.
Our commitment as an exporter to the Bahamas involves providing equipment that can withstand the corrosive maritime environment. Humidity and salt air are significant factors; hence our automated warehouse handling equipment is engineered with specialized anti-corrosion coatings and robust electrical sealing to ensure longevity in the Caribbean climate.
